Learn more about GuardScore**What is CSFloat?** CSFloat is a digital marketplace founded in 2020 and headquartered in Wilmington, United States. It caters to gamers, specifically those interested in Counter-Strike 2 (CS2) skins and other Steam in-game items. The company has a small team of around 2 to 10 employees and specializes in providing a secure environment for skin trading. Its primary audience consists of players who seek a platform to safely trade digital game assets. **How does it work?** CSFloat’s platform allows users to list, buy, and sell CS2 skins and other Steam items using real money transactions. The marketplace connects buyers and sellers in a peer-to-peer setting, with security measures to protect transactions and items exchanged. The platform manages the trade process to ensure that skins are delivered after payment, minimizing fraud risk. It focuses on digital goods that are popular in the gaming community, particularly among Counter-Strike players. **Products and services** CSFloat offers a marketplace for digital goods, particularly in-game items for Counter-Strike 2 and Steam. Users can create listings for their skins or browse available items to purchase. The platform supports real money payments and handles the trade fulfillment process. It does not manufacture or develop video games but acts as an intermediary service specialized in skin trading. The service includes user account management, trade security, and a curated selection of gaming digital assets.

A lot of users say CSFloat is legit and better than the Steam market, but some have reported scams and account hacks. So, it's good to be cautious and maybe do some research before jumping in.
Some people have unfortunately dealt with account compromises and suggest contacting support immediately if it happens to you. Keeping your email secure is also a must since hackers can use it to create accounts and mess with your balance.
Users mention that while CSFloat generally has lower fees compared to other platforms, there could be some additional costs that aren't immediately obvious. It's always worth reading the fine print before making transactions.
Most people recommend checking the wear of skins carefully and only dealing with verified accounts if you can. CSFloat manages trades, which helps reduce fraud, but it's still a good practice to be vigilant.
If a trade doesn't go as planned, users usually recommend bringing it up with CSFloat's support team to see if they can help. User experiences vary, but being proactive about issues seems to be key.
Yes, some users have reported new scams where accounts are hacked and used to buy overpriced items. It's a good idea to keep your account secure and be wary of suspicious activity.
